Stryker Receives Two Subpoenas for Device Marketing

Stryker Corporation has received two subpoenas from the U.S. Department of Justice regarding the OtisKnee and PainPump marketing, according to various reports.

The subpoenas were filed with the Securities and Exchange Commission regarding regulatory matters related to the sales and marketing of the devices. Stryker is still in the process of responding to the subpoenas, according to the Wall Street Journal report.

The OtisKnee subpoena is connected to alleged issues prior to Stryker acquiring OtisMed, according to the Benzinga report.
